Hawaii Pacific released the following statement on the status of head women’s basketball coach Reid Takatsuka: Takatsuka is the winningest active collegiate basketball coach in the state of Hawaii. The veteran coach is his 11th season at HPU, and has a career record of 213-71. More on this story as it continues to develop.

Craig tabbed as Interim Head Women’s Basketball Coach at Alaska Fairbanks
The Alaska Nanook women’s basketball team and Director of Athletics, Brock Anundson, have announced the elevation of Jessie Craig from assistant coach to interim head coach. Moreland named Assistant Women’s Basketball Coach at Pitt Johnstown
Former Pitt-Johnstown standout Tori Moreland has been named an assistant women’s basketball coach at her alma mater under Head Coach Mike Drahos. Moreland, a member of the Pitt-Johnstown women’s basketball team from 2015-2019 team, was a three-year starter and two-year team captain. Jarrett named Assistant Women’s Basketball Coach & Academic Services Coordinator at PNW
Head Coach and Senior Woman Administrator Courtney Locke announced Natalie Jarrett has joined the Purdue Northwest women’s basketball staff as Assistant Coach and Academic Services Coordinator.
